HISTORIC HIDEAWAY AT THE EPICENTER OF THE HILL! Tucked within one of Capitol Hill’s storied inner-block enclaves, LITERALLY just steps to SCOTUS, the Senate, Library of Congress, and the U.S. Capitol. Charming 1889 alley community offers a rare chance to live at the literal heart of American democracy — with roof deck views toward the highest court in the land. Quietly set behind the grand avenues, yet moments to Pennsylvania & Massachusetts Avenues, Eastern Market, Union Station, and Metro. Distinctive 19th-century details — corbelled brick cornices, segmental arches, transom entry, and exposed brick — frame a smart modern interior where gleaming wood floors anchor open living and dining spaces with built-in oak shelving and central fireplace. The sleek kitchen pairs black granite counters with custom oak cabinetry, while a rear glass door opens to a private garden and spiral stair to the rooftop deck . A striking main-level bath clad in floor-to-ceiling stone delivers spa-like escape. Upstairs, two vaulted bedrooms with generous closets, built-ins, laundry, and flexible Murphy bed complete the picture.
